The
Phase Problem
arises in fields like
X-ray Crystallography
and
Electron Microscopy
, where only the
Magnitude of a wave's Fourier transform
can be measured, but not its phase, leading to incomplete information about the structure being studied. Solving the
Phase Problem
is crucial for accurate
Structure Determination
, often requiring
Computational Techniques
or additional
Experimental Data
to reconstruct the missing
Phase Information
.
